/**
* A message for communicating squad invitation.
* When received by a client, the event message "You have invited `name` to join your squad" is produced
* and a `SquadMembershipRequest` packet of type `Invite`
* using `char_id` as the optional unique character identifier field is dispatched to the server.
* The message is equivalent to a dispatched packet of type `SquadMembershipResponse`
* with an `Invite` event with the referral field set to `true`.
* @see `SquadMembershipResponse`
* @param squad_guid the squad's GUID
* @param slot a potentially valid slot index;
* 0-9; higher numbers produce no response
* @param char_id the unique character identifier
* @param name the character's name;
* frequently, though that does not produce a coherent message,
* the avatar's own name is supplied in the event message instead of the name of another player
*/
final case class SquadInvitationRequestMessage(squad_guid : PlanetSideGUID,
slot : Int,
char_id : Long,
name : String)
extends PlanetSideGamePacket {
type Packet = SquadInvitationRequestMessage
def opcode = GamePacketOpcode.SquadInvitationRequestMessage
def encode = SquadInvitationRequestMessage.encode(this)
}
object SquadInvitationRequestMessage extends Marshallable[SquadInvitationRequestMessage] {
implicit val codec : Codec[SquadInvitationRequestMessage] = (
("squad_guid" | PlanetSideGUID.codec) ::
("slot" | uint4) ::
("char_id" | uint32L) ::
("name" | PacketHelpers.encodedWideStringAligned(adjustment = 4))
).as[SquadInvitationRequestMessage]
}

/**
* The dedicated messaging switchboard for members and observers of a given squad.
* It almost always dispatches messages to `WorldSessionActor` instances, much like any other `Service`.
* The sole purpose of this `ActorBus` container is to manage a subscription model
* that can involuntarily drop subscribers without informing them explicitly
* or can just vanish without having to properly clean itself up.
*/
class SquadSwitchboard extends Actor {
/**
* This collection contains the message-sending contact reference for squad members.
* Users are added to this collection via the `SquadSwitchboard.Join` message, or a
* combination of the `SquadSwitchboard.DelayJoin` message followed by a
* `SquadSwitchboard.Join` message with or without an `ActorRef` hook.
* The message `SquadSwitchboard.Leave` removes the user from this collection.
* key - unique character id; value - `Actor` reference for that character
*/
val UserActorMap : mutable.LongMap[ActorRef] = mutable.LongMap[ActorRef]()
/**
* This collection contains the message-sending contact information for would-be squad members.
* Users are added to this collection via the `SquadSwitchboard.DelayJoin` message
* and are promoted to an actual squad member through a `SquadSwitchboard.Join` message.
* The message `SquadSwitchboard.Leave` removes the user from this collection.
* key - unique character id; value - `Actor` reference for that character
*/
val DelayedJoin : mutable.LongMap[ActorRef] = mutable.LongMap[ActorRef]()
/**
* This collection contains the message-sending contact information for squad observers.
* Squad observers only get "details" messages as opposed to the sort of messages squad members receive.
* Squad observers are promoted to an actual squad member through a `SquadSwitchboard.Watch` message.
* The message `SquadSwitchboard.Leave` removes the user from this collection.
* The message `SquadSwitchboard.Unwatch` also removes the user from this collection.
* key - unique character id; value - `Actor` reference for that character
*/
val Watchers : mutable.LongMap[ActorRef] = mutable.LongMap[ActorRef]()
override def postStop() : Unit = {
UserActorMap.clear()
DelayedJoin.clear()
Watchers.clear()
}
